The core of this system lies in its integrated RO + UV + UF + TDS Control architecture. By utilizing 7 Stages of filtration, the unit sequentially removes suspended solids, dissolved salts, and biological contaminants. The 15 Litres/Hour output speed is facilitated by a high-pressure pump designed to drive water through the semi-permeable RO membrane efficiently. This throughput ensures that the 12-litre storage tank replenishes quickly after heavy usage. Comparing this model to entry-level sediment filters reveals a significant leap in chemical reduction capabilities. The UF stage acts as a final physical barrier, ensuring that even if the RO membrane experiences slight scaling, the water remains clear and safe for consumption.
Technical robustness is highlighted by its ability to manage a TDS threshold of 2000 PPM. This capability is vital for regions where borewell water contains high concentrations of calcium and magnesium. The internal components are housed in a food-grade plastic chassis that balances weight and structural integrity. Operating at 60 W, the electrical assembly is optimized to handle voltage fluctuations common in domestic Indian grids. While the noise profile is standard for RO systems, the vibration dampening around the pump helps maintain a tolerable environment during the purification cycles. The TDS controller provides a manual bypass to mix purified water with filtered water, maintaining a healthy mineral balance throughout the day.
